What are ethics?

A. A statement made from facts that apply to a grip rather than a person

B. Moral principles that govern the behavior of a person or group

C. Any preference or prejudices that a person has

D. A way of seeing something or a way of thinking

    Ethics are moral principles that govern the behavior of a person or group.

    In other words, it's the study of values and how we should live as human beings. Ethics is used with morals and values.
